内容管理系统使用教程:轻松上手WordPress主题定制

  • 时间:
  • 浏览:0
  • 来源:MIP站群系统

嘿,朋友们!今天咱们来聊聊WordPress主题定制。如果你是个刚开始接触内容管理系统(CMS)的新手,可能一听到“主题定制”这个词就有点发怵。别担心,其实这玩意儿没你想的那么复杂。只要你跟着我的步骤来,保证你能轻松上手,甚至还能做出一个属于你自己的网站风格。来吧,咱们开始吧!

首先,先搞清楚什么是WordPress主题。简单来说,主题就是你网站的“外衣”。它决定了你的网站看起来是什么样的,包括颜色、字体、布局、按钮样式等等。WordPress自带了一些默认主题,比如Twenty Twenty-One、Twenty Twenty-Two这些,但如果你想让你的网站与众不同,那就得动手定制一下了。

不过,别急着改代码!很多人一开始都会犯一个错误,就是直接去改主题的源代码。这样虽然能实现效果,但一旦主题更新,你的修改就全白瞎了。所以,正确的做法是使用子主题(Child Theme)。子主题可以继承父主题的所有功能和样式,同时允许你进行个性化修改,而不用担心更新后丢失改动。听起来是不是很香?那怎么创建子主题呢?其实也挺简单的。

首先,你需要在你的WordPress后台进入外观 > 主题,然后点击“添加新主题”。在搜索栏里输入“child theme”或者“子主题”,会出现一些现成的插件,比如“Child Theme Configurator”之类的。安装并启用它之后,它会引导你一步步创建子主题。当然,如果你有点技术基础,也可以手动创建一个文件夹,然后写一个style.css文件,里面加上模板名称、父主题等信息,再通过FTP上传到服务器上。不过对于新手来说,用插件更省事。

好,子主题创建好了,接下来就是修改样式的问题。这时候你可以用浏览器的开发者工具(按F12就能打开)查看你网站上的元素,找到你想修改的部分,比如导航栏的颜色、按钮的样式、文章标题的字体大小等等。然后在子主题的style.css文件里添加自定义的CSS代码。比如你想把文章标题的字体颜色改成红色,就可以写上一句:

.entry-title { color: red; }

保存之后刷新网站,就能看到效果了。是不是很简单?当然,如果你对CSS不太熟,也没关系,网上有很多现成的代码片段可以直接复制粘贴,比如在CodePen、CSS-Tricks这些网站上找灵感。

除了修改样式,你还可以自定义模板文件。比如你想修改首页的布局,可以在子主题中复制父主题的index.php文件,然后进行修改。这时候你可能需要一点点PHP基础,但别担心,大多数主题的模板结构都很清晰,你只需要找到对应的HTML结构,调整一下顺序或者添加一些自定义内容就可以了。

还有一个很实用的功能就是使用WordPress的“自定义器”(Customizer)。在外观 > 自定义里面,你可以实时预览对网站的修改,包括颜色、字体、菜单、小工具、背景图片等等。这个功能特别适合那些不想写代码的朋友,因为它是可视化的,点点鼠标就能搞定。不过它的功能也有一定限制,如果你想做更复杂的定制,还是得回到代码层面。

说到小工具,咱们也得提一下。WordPress的小工具系统非常强大,你可以通过外观 > 小工具来添加各种功能模块到侧边栏、页脚或者其他区域。比如你可以添加一个社交媒体链接小工具、一个最近文章的列表、一个订阅表单等等。这些都可以通过拖拽的方式完成,完全不需要写代码。

最后,别忘了响应式设计的重要性。现在大家浏览网页的设备五花八门,有手机、平板、电脑,所以你的主题必须能适应不同的屏幕尺寸。大多数现代WordPress主题都已经是响应式的了,但如果你自己定制了布局,一定要测试一下在不同设备上的显示效果。可以用浏览器的开发者工具切换设备尺寸,或者直接用手机访问看看。

总结一下,WordPress主题定制其实并不难,只要你掌握了基本的思路和工具,比如使用子主题、添加自定义CSS、利用自定义器和小工具,基本上就能满足大部分需求了。当然,如果你想要更高级的功能,比如自定义页面模板、开发插件、或者使用JavaScript添加交互效果,那就得深入学习一下前端和后端的知识了。

总之,别怕折腾,多试多练,慢慢你就会发现,定制WordPress主题其实是一件很有趣的事情。希望这篇教程能帮你打开这扇门,祝你建站愉快,早日成为WordPress高手!

相关内容

CMS建站入门:选择合适的CMS平台

内容管理系统CMS的优劣分析与选择建议

cms建站教程:从零开始搭建企业官网

常用系统CMS使用教程:提升网站管理效率的方法

最新站长资讯汇总

WordPress内容管理系统建站入门教程

常用CMS建站工具对比分析

如何选择合适的CMS进行网站开发

WordPress插件使用技巧提升建站效率

WordPress内容管理系统建站基础教程